Stuffed pork loin is a traditional Spanish dish that has always been appreciated for its intense flavor and juicy texture. With this method, you will achieve exquisite meat wrapped in a delicious combination of flavors including brie cheese and cooked ham.

Ingredients

For this recipe, you’ll need classic ingredients like onions, carrots, garlic, and fresh rosemary to add flavor to the meat. Brie cheese is a key ingredient that provides a creamy texture and mild flavor that complements pork loin perfectly. On the other hand, cooked ham adds an additional layer of flavor and integrates with the meat to create a exquisite blend.

Step-by-Step

  1. Start by slicing the onion into rings and cutting the carrot into slices.
  2. Crush the garlic cloves and wash the fresh rosemary sprigs.
  3. Preheat the oven to 180 ºC and dice the brie cheese for the filling.
  4. Lay out the pork loin on a clean surface, ensuring it is well spread out and free of excess fat.
  5. Generously season the meat with salt and pepper and place the cooked ham over it to form the base of the filling.
  6. Add pieces of brie cheese over the ham, distributing them evenly.
  7. Carefully roll up the pork loin around the filling, making sure it is well sealed to prevent it from coming apart during cooking.
  8. Season the exterior of the roll with salt and pepper again and secure it with a net or string to maintain its shape during baking.
  9. Grease an oven-safe dish and place the onion rings at the bottom.
  10. Place the meat roll on top of the onions, ensuring it is centered well.
  11. Distribute the carrot slices, crushed garlic cloves, and some peppercorns around the roll.
  12. Pour white wine over the meat and vegetables to add an extra layer of flavor.
  13. Add the rosemary sprigs on top.
  14. Bake for 45 minutes at 180 ºC until fully cooked.

Tips and Techniques

  • Spread the meat carefully: Ensure that the pork loin is well spread out to facilitate rolling.
  • Cover adequately: The amount of brie cheese and ham should be sufficient to cover the entire surface of the loin, but not excessive to avoid coming apart during baking.
  • Secure with string or net: This is crucial for maintaining the shape of the roll during cooking and ensuring that the ingredients do not come out.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Not spreading the meat enough: If the pork loin is rolled up when it has not been spread out properly, it can result in a too tough texture.
  2. Using too much or too little filling ingredients: The quantity of cheese and ham should be balanced so that they do not come apart during baking.
  3. Not securing well with string or net: If the meat is poorly sealed, it may fall apart in the oven, leaving the ingredients scattered throughout the tray.

How to Know It Turned Out Right

The stuffed pork loin has cooked perfectly when the meat acquires a golden color and comes out clean when pierced with a fork. Additionally, the brie cheese should be melted and fused inside, while the ham should maintain its texture without falling apart.
